Electromagnetic vibrating feeder is a kind of linear direction feeding equipment. It has features of smooth vibrating, reliable in operation, long service life and suitable for feeding. They are widely used in mining, building, silicate and chemical industries for crushing and screening.

Characteristics:

(1) Small cubage, light weight, simple structure, easily fixed, no movement assembly, no lubrication, maintain easily.

(2) Electromagnetic vibrating feeder uses up less electric energy because of the engine vibrating resonance principle and double plastid works at the low critical nearly resonance.

(3) The feeding size is higher accuracy because it can change and start or close material flow instantaneously.

(4) Control equipment of this series Electric-Magnetic Vibrating Machine adopts the controlled silicon half wave whole line. During the usage, the feeding size can be adjusted easily by adjusting the controlled

opened corner. The production line is controlled by concentrating automatically.

(5) The damage of chute is little because the material that in the chute is continuously thrown when feeding, and along the track of parabola moves bound toward.

(6) This series Electromagnetic vibrating feeder is not suitable for the flameproof conditions.
